Market cap is the total market value to buy the whole company. It is equal to the share price times the number of Shares Outstanding (EOP). Stolt-Nielsen's share price for the quarter that ended in Feb. 2026 was €29.95. Stolt-Nielsen's Shares Outstanding (EOP) for the quarter that ended in Feb. 2026 was 66 Mil. Therefore, Stolt-Nielsen's market cap for the quarter that ended in Feb. 2026 was €1,989 Mil.

Stolt-Nielsen's quarterly market cap increased from Aug. 2025 (€1,839 Mil) to Nov. 2025 (€1,912 Mil) and increased from Nov. 2025 (€1,912 Mil) to Feb. 2026 (€1,989 Mil).

Stolt-Nielsen's annual market cap declined from Nov. 2023 (€1,780 Mil) to Nov. 2024 (€1,602 Mil) but then increased from Nov. 2024 (€1,602 Mil) to Nov. 2025 (€1,912 Mil).

Enterprise Value is the theoretical takeover price. It is more comprehensive than market capitalization (market cap), which only includes common equity. Enterprise Value is calculated as the market cap plus debt and minority interest and preferred shares, minus total cash and cash equivalents. Stolt-Nielsen's Enterprise Value for Today is €3,833 Mil.


Stolt-Nielsen  (HAM:SN6) Market Cap Explanation

Market cap is not the real price you pay for a company. If you buy the company and become its owner, you become the owner of the cash the company has, and you also assume the company’s debt. The real price you pay is the Enterprise Value.

Warren Buffett uses the ratio of total market cap of all public traded companies over GDP to measure if the market is expensive. As of April 2012, the US total market cap is about $14.7 trillion, while the US GDP is about $15 trillion. The market was modestly overvalued.

Stolt-Nielsen Business Description

Address 2 Church Street, Clarendon House, Hamilton, BMU, HM 11
Stolt-Nielsen Ltd is a transportation and logistics company domiciled in Bermuda. The company organizes itself into five business segments: Tankers, Terminals, Tank Containers, Stolt Sea Farm, and Stolt-Nielsen Gas. The Group generates the majority of its operating revenue through its tanker segment from the transportation of liquids by sea and inland waterways under contracts of affreightment or through contracts on the spot market. Geographically, the company generates a majority of its revenue from the United States and the rest from Belgium, China, and other regions.
